Transaction ee329e58faa18ae0153debc3e93d17126c7fdf3a5387773e7b015b7fa957dd43
1 Input
1 Output
-
ee329e58faa18ae0153debc3e93d17126c7fdf3a5387773e7b015b7fa957dd43:0
- value
- 16028680
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4b49e561292c3f85f18feeb09a7db26b5ff85e4
- address
- bc1quj6fu4sjjtplshcclm4snf7my66llp0y4vnqq5